What is the origin of the proverb "fair and softly goes far in a day" and when to use it?
The origin of the proverb "fair and softly goes far in a day" is believed to be derived from traditional wisdom, with the phrase appearing in various forms since the 16th century. It emphasizes the value of patience, persistence, and careful consideration in achieving success. The proverb encourages individuals to proceed with thoughtfulness and balance, as slow and steady progress often leads to more significant, long-term outcomes than hasty or aggressive efforts.
Example
When training for a marathon, it's important to pace yourself and build up your endurance gradually, as fair and softly goes far in a day.
